For manufacturers seeking a considerable improvement in their production abilities, 4-axis CNC machining centers offer a robust approach. Unlike 3-axis machines that are constrained to flat cuts, these advanced systems feature a rotational pivot, permitting the production of complex three-dimensional items and surfaces. This technology delivers superior versatility and exactness, enabling it suitable for uses spanning from cabinetry production to graphics and modeling.
4-Axis CNC Router Capabilities: Beyond the Basics
While most know standard 3-axis CNC systems for straightforward milling and carving, considering 4-axis capabilities opens a world of innovative applications. Such fourth axis, typically rotation around the X or C axis, permits users to create detailed sculptural designs previously unattainable with standard 3-axis systems. Think about producing ornate sculptures, angled pieces, or working complex areas with ease. Furthermore, 4-axis routing sometimes lowers changeover times and increases total component precision.
Selecting the Ideal 4-Axis Computer Numerical Control System for Your Business
Deciding which 4-axis CNC machine suits your needs involves a challenging evaluation. Consider your work ' size requirements ; will you be handling large sheets of material ? Furthermore , assess the sorts of materials you plan to cut —different materials necessitate varying spindle velocities and power . Ultimately, factor in your budget and future expansion prospects.

Troubleshooting Common Issues with 4-Axis CNC Routers
Encountering difficulties with your multi-axis CNC router ? Don't stress! Many frequent challenges are more info fairly resolved with a small of insight. Regularly, faulty toolpaths can result in unpredictable machining, while loose wiring may trigger electrical outages. Additionally , incorrect speeds or lacking holding can produce vibration and subpar quality . Start by carefully checking the program and components before seeking professional help .
